What is an Integrated Electric Oven?
An integrated electric oven is designed to blend perfectly into kitchen cabinets. Unlike freestanding models, integrated ovens are built within the kitchen units, using a structured look that numerous homeowners desire. These appliances can be compact or large, depending on kitchen area and cooking needs.

Aesthetic Appeal
Integrated electric ovens provide a clean and cohesive look to the kitchen. By fitting comfortably within kitchen cabinetry, they eliminate the visual mess typically associated with standalone designs.
Space-Saving Design
For smaller sized kitchen areas, an integrated design permits users to maximize area without compromising on performance. The style enhances vertical area, maximizing valuable counter location.
Advanced Cooking Options
Modern integrated electric ovens come geared up with various cooking modes, such as convection, steam, and rotisserie. These functions allow users to prepare a larger variety of dishes with accuracy.
Energy Efficiency
Integrated electric ovens usually take in less energy compared to their gas equivalents. With advancements in technology, they offer faster heating times while guaranteeing constant cooking outcomes.
Enhanced Safety Features
Numerous integrated electric ovens are equipped with automated shut-off functions and cool-touch doors, guaranteeing safety during cooking and minimizing the dangers of burns.
Considerations When Choosing an Integrated Electric Oven
When choosing the right Integrated Oven electric electric oven, a number of factors must be thought about:
Size and Capacity: Before making a selection, it is important to measure the designated space in the kitchen. Likewise, consider whether a single or double oven is preferable based upon cooking routines.
Mounting Options: Integrated ovens can be mounted in various setups (under-counter or in wall cabinets). Assess which choice makes the most of kitchen workflow while keeping ease of access.
Budget plan: Integrated electric ovens can vary significantly in expense. Define a budget range beforehand to limit options. Make certain to consider long-term energy cost savings against the initial financial investment.
Brand Reputation: Research brand names known for sturdiness and dependability. Client reviews and expert opinions can provide valuable insights into performance.
